Heat advisory issued

The National Weather Service has issued a heat advisory for all of East Central Illinois until 7p.m. Wednesday.  The advisory includes Champaign, Coles, DeWitt, Douglas, Ford, Iroquois, Macon, Moultrie, Piatt, Shelby and Vermilion counties.  Temperatures are expected to reach into the low to mid 90s, with the heat index reaching as high as 105 degrees.
